Charles de Foucauld
Blessed Charles Eugène de Foucauld
(15 September 1858 – 1 December 1916) was a
French
Catholic
religious
and
priest
living among the
Tuareg
in the
Sahara
in
Algeria
. He was assassinated in 1916 outside the door of the fort he built for the protection of the Tuareg, and is considered by the
Catholic Church
to be a
martyr
. His inspiration and writings led to the founding of the
Little Brothers of Jesus
among other
religious congregations
. He was
beatified
on 13 November 2005 by
Pope Benedict XVI
.
